This specification covers a titanium alloy in the form of bars, forgings, and stock for forging.
These products have been used typically for parts requiring good weldability and ductility, combined with good notch-toughness down to -320 \mDF (-196 \mDC), but usage is not limited to such applications.
Certain processing procedures and service conditions may cause these products to become subject to stress-corrosion; SAE ARP 982 recommends practices to minimize such conditions.
